Reads Ethereum Attestation Service records for an address and sorts them by what they are actually worth. Each attestation carries its issuer, schema, decoded field values, issue time and expiry. The result separates four states that look identical in a raw list: currently valid, revoked by the issuer, expired, and self-issued — an attestation someone wrote about themselves proves nothing and is counted apart rather than mixed into the total.
